Phosphoric acid (H_(3)PO_(4)) is tribasic acid and one of its salt is sodium dihydrogen phosphate (NaH_(2)PO_(4)). What volume of 1 M NaOH solution should be added to 12 g of sodium dihydrogen phosphate (mol. Wt. 120) to exactly convert it into trisodium phosphate Na_(3)PO_(4) |
|
Answer» 80 ml |
